The width of a rectangle is increasing at a rate of 5 inches per second and its length is increasing at the rate of 9 inches per

second. At what rate is the area of the rectangle increasing when its width is 2 inches and its length is 3 ​inches

Answer:

The area of rectangle is changing at the rate of 33 square inches per second.        

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given the following information:

Let W be the width of the rectangle and L be the length of rectangle.

Rate of change of width = \frac{dW}{dt} = 5\text{ inches per second}

Rate of change of length = \frac{dL}{dt} = 9\text{ inches per second}

We have to find rate of change of area at W = 2 and L = 3.

Rate of change of area = \frac{dA}{dt}

Area of rectangle = Length × Width

\frac{dA}{dt} = \frac{d(LW)}{dt} = L\frac{dW}{dt} + W\frac{dL}{dt}

Putting the values, we get

\frac{dA}{dt} = 3(5) + 2(9) = 33\text{ square inches per second}

The area of rectangle is changing at the rate of 33 square inches per second.
